Excellent road, rail and air options make visiting two or more cities on the same holiday a feasible option. BOSTON AND WASHINGTON DC Linking these east coast cities is easy by rail, via Amtrak’s Acela train or on its slower but less expensive Northeast Regional service. See Boston’s Faneuil Hall and Quincy Market and take a harbour cruise. In the capital, rent a bike to explore the National Mall and monuments then enjoy its museums and restaurant scene. SAN FRANCISCO AND HAWAII Hop on one of San Francisco’s cable cars to explore the city. Stroll Chinatown, Fisherman’s Wharf and Pier 39 and board a Bay cruise to visit Alcatraz and sail under the Golden Gate Bridge. Then fly to Hawaii for the tropical lifestyle of Oahu island’s Honolulu and Waikiki Beach before experiencing the contrasting natural splendour of Volcanoes National Park on Big Island and the lush rainforests of Kauai. LOS ANGELES AND PALM SPRINGS Los Angeles is a feast for the senses, from the bright lights of Hollywood to the urban excitement of downtown and beach neighbourhoods Santa Monica, Venice Beach and Malibu. A two-hour road trip takes you to chic desert oasis and long-time celebs’ favourite, Palm Springs, with its spa resorts, a walkable and lively downtown, outdoor adventure activities, golf galore, stunning scenery and its Aerial Tramway. CHICAGO, MEMPHIS AND NEW ORLEANS Indulge yourself in all things jazz, blues and rock ‘n’ roll on a three-centre itinerary through 900 miles of musical heritage. Amtrak makes the going easy on its daily City of New Orleans service, which takes 19 hours for the Chicago-New Orleans journey. After sampling the Windy City’s blues clubs, stop off in Memphis to soak up the live music scene of Beale Street, ending in New Orleans for its jazz-filled French Quarter.
